A man by the name of William Moldt was reported missing on the 7th November 1997 from Lantana, Florida. He failed to make it home from a night out at the age of 40 and hasn’t been found since the day he went missing. A missing person case started after the strange disappearance of William; however, the case went cold and no evidence was found for so long. Fast forward 22 years, police were called to the scene of a sunken car found in a pond in Moon Bay Circle, Wellington. The vehicle was pulled out of the water and skeletal remains were found inside the car. They started to investigate the remains to see if they can find out who it is and identify how long it’s been stuck in that pond, however a week later, they found out that the remains were William Moldt. The sunken car was found after someone was doing a google search on the location, police have said.

The man that contacted the police reported this after looking on Google Maps and finding something strange in his nearby pond, curious to know what it is he decided to use his drone to find out if this is still in the pond or been taken out already, once he found out that the car was still visible in the pond, he contacted the police and they came as soon as possible to check out the situation. It is presumed that William Moldt lost control of his vehicle and drove straight into the pond.
